Nikkei here. The mochi ice cream was invented based off the daifuku and gyūhi popular in Nikkei wagashi shops. If you're near a city with a Japantown, see if there are traditional sweet shops, or you could order some generic mass-produced ones online: https://www.amazon.com/Japanese-Fruits-Daifuku-Rice-strawberry/dp/B000TRHKGG or https://www.amazon.com/Royal-Family-Japanese-Mochi-Daifuku/dp/B003SPM64C

u/chlamers · 2 pointsr/bayarea

Are you talking about these mochi blocks? Like hard as a rock until cooked? If so Nijiya or Mitsuwa has them. I personally like to put them in a waffle iron to make mochi waffles and they are indeed crispy and chewy.
